In the video, we will explain the gradual genesis and physical essence of the equivalent circuit of the transformer. We begin slowly by describing an ideal (mathematical) transformer, which we gradually complicate by considering its natural physical properties. The result is a standard T-shape equivalent circuit known from the commonly available literature. The video emphasizes understanding why the equivalent circuit looks the way it does :).
Content in points:
- Introduction of the concept of an ideal transformer (equivalent circuit)
- Explanation of the transformer principle
- Gradual consideration of parasitic effects (leakage magnetic flux, losses) and rebuilding the idealized equivalent scheme
- Explanation of the final equivalent circuit of the transformer
